Wall Inspection and Repair
Examining wall surfaces for any blemishes and immediately resolving them through necessary repairs is essential for accomplishing a smooth and remarkable paint task. Before starting the painting process, very carefully take a look at the wall surfaces for cracks, openings, damages, or any other damages that can influence the outcome.

For bigger dents or damaged locations, think about making use of joint compound to ensure a smooth repair work.
Furthermore, look for any kind of loosened paint or wallpaper that might need to be gotten rid of. Scrape off any peeling paint or old wallpaper, and sand the surface to create an uniform appearance.
It's additionally necessary to check for water damage, as this can lead to mold and mildew growth and influence the bond of the new paint. Address any type of water stains or mold with the appropriate cleaning solutions prior to proceeding with the painting process.
Cleaning and Surface Preparation
To ensure an immaculate and well-prepared surface area for painting, the next action involves extensively cleansing and prepping the wall surfaces. Begin by dusting the walls with a microfiber cloth or a duster to eliminate any kind of loosened dust, webs, or debris.
For more persistent dirt or crud, a solution of mild cleaning agent and water can be utilized to gently scrub the walls, followed by a complete rinse with tidy water. Pay unique attention to locations near light buttons, door deals with, and baseboards, as these often tend to gather more dust.
After cleansing, it is vital to examine the wall surfaces for any kind of cracks, openings, or imperfections. These should be loaded with spackling substance and sanded smooth once completely dry. Sanding the walls gently with fine-grit sandpaper will certainly also assist create a consistent surface for painting.
Priming and Insulation
Before paint, the wall surfaces should be primed to make sure appropriate attachment of the paint and taped to secure adjacent surfaces from roaming brushstrokes. Priming acts as a vital action in the paint process, particularly for new drywall or surface areas that have been patched or repaired. It aids secure the wall surface, producing a smooth and uniform surface for the paint to abide by. Additionally, guide can boost the durability and protection of the paint, ultimately bring about a more expert and resilient surface.

Painter's tape is created to be conveniently used and removed without damaging the underlying surface area or leaving behind any residue. Make the effort to properly tape off areas prior to repainting to conserve on your own the inconvenience of touch-ups in the future.
